
VGChartz reports that their estimated worldwide hardware and software chart for week ending April 4th, 2008 is as follows:
Hardware Totals: [Last Week #]
DSL: 365,941 (+8%) [337,332]
Wii: 340,698 (+42%) [239,477]
PSP: 250,961 (-6%) [268,127]
PS3: 186,054 (-21%) [234,252]
PS2: 135,242 (-6%) [144,132]
360: 134,079 (-17%) [162,297]
Top 10 Software Worldwide:
1. Monster Hunter Freedom 2nd G (PSP) 581,102 1,438,531
2 Wii Sports (Wii) 304,873 20,804,645
3 Gran Turismo 5 Prologue (PS3) 270,558 907,547
4 Warriors Orochi: Maou Sairin (PS2) 215,643 215,643 [NEW]
5 Super Smash Bros Brawl (Wii) 176,108 3,982,476
6 Wii Play (Wii) 169,297 11,114,735
7 Call of Duty 4: Modern Warfare (360) 127,127 5,538,640
8 Tom Clancy's Rainbow Six: Vegas 2 (360) 125,226 930,622
9 Mario & Sonic at the Olympic Games (DS) 100,629 1,410,819
10 Mario & Sonic at the Olympic Games (Wii) 96,195 3,851,115
New Software Releases for this week:
12 Star Ocean: The Second Evolution (PSP)89,947 89,947 [NEW]
15 Pro Baseball Spirits 5 (PS2) 80,277 80,277 [NEW]
30 Yoiko's Life on an Uninhabited Island (DS)54,082 54,082 [NEW]
32 Pro Baseball Spirits 5 (PS3) 52,452 52,452 [NEW]
Software Totals: (Last Week #)
Wii: 1,847,374 (1,784,571)
DSL: 1,780,242 (1,872,121)
360: 1,336,704 (1,524,577)
PS3: 1,177,929 (1,373,522)
PSP: 1,124,696 (1,571,427)
PS2: 785,376 (625,740)
